UniPhier System LSI Features
Thanks to its flexibility and extensibility, the UniPhier processor can be used in applications ranging from mobile phones requiring low power consumption to high-performance home entertainment products. Additionally, the architecture simplifies the development of system LSIs that meet the requirements of specific products.

UniPhier System LSI for Mobile Phones (Example)
- UniPhier processor capable of implementing high-performance mobile codecs
- Ability to implement high-quality, high-performance AV playback thanks to a high-speed CPU and dedicated display processing engine
- Support for advanced applications such as 1-segment DTV
UniPhier System LSI for Portable AV (Example)
- UniPhier processor capable of implementing high-performance codecs for portable audio/video devices
- CPU combining low power consumption and high performance
- Implementation of H.264 recording and playback of full-HD AVCHD standard compatible video
- Interfaces for SD card, optical disc, HDD, and USB media
UniPhier System LSI for Home Entertainment (Example)
- UniPhier processor capable of simultaneously decoding dual HD video streams
- Dual-core CPU combining low power consumption with high performance
- High-quality video signal processing with a built-in dedicated graphics engine
- Stream I/O group with Blu-ray Disc™ and HDTV support
